Greco Roman wrestler Viresh Kundu bagged a Bronze medal on Day 2 of the Asian Junior Championships in New Delhi yesterday. 

The 20-year old, who hails from Uttar Pradesh, defeated South Korea's Jeongyul Kwon, 14-5 in the 97 kg Bronze medal play-off to win his first international medal. 

Apart from Kundu, none of the Indian



grapplers managed to win a medal yesterday, as the Greco-Roman competitions came to a close.

On the opening day of the Championships, India had clinched 4 medals - 1 Gold, 2 Silver and 1 Bronze.

Women's wrestling will begin today, with Freestyle competitions slated to start on Saturday.
